About

Eugene Shostak is a rising figure in interventional pulmonology, with a research focus on minimally invasive diagnostic and therapeutic techniques for lung cancer and metastatic disease. His major contributions center on advancing robotic-assisted bronchoscopy (RAB) as a safer, more accurate alternative to conventional navigation bronchoscopy. In his highly cited 2023 systematic review and meta-analysis (71 citations), Shostak demonstrated that RAB platforms significantly improve diagnostic yield for pulmonary lesions while maintaining an excellent safety profile, establishing a new benchmark for precision in lung biopsy. He has also explored the integration of interventional pulmonology with radiology, as seen in his 2021 overview, and is pioneering the use of pulsed electric field (PEF) ablation for metastatic cancer. His 2025 study on PEF ablation safety, conducted before standard-of-care therapy, represents a novel approach to combining biopsy with local tumor destruction. Shostak’s work is notable for bridging technical innovation with rigorous evidence synthesis, directly impacting clinical guidelines and patient care. His research continues to shape the future of lung cancer diagnosis and treatment.
